Buying Guide for the Best Automatic Threading Sewing Machines

Choosing the right automatic-threading sewing machine can make your sewing projects more enjoyable and efficient. These machines are designed to save you time and effort by automatically threading the needle, which can be a tedious task. When selecting a sewing machine, it's important to consider various specifications to ensure it meets your needs and preferences. Here are some key specs to look out for and how to navigate them.
Automatic Needle ThreaderThe automatic needle threader is a feature that threads the needle for you, saving time and reducing eye strain. This is especially important for those who sew frequently or have difficulty threading needles manually. Look for machines with a reliable and easy-to-use automatic needle threader. If you have poor eyesight or shaky hands, this feature can be a game-changer.
Stitch OptionsStitch options refer to the variety of stitches a sewing machine can perform, such as straight, zigzag, decorative, and buttonhole stitches. More stitch options provide greater versatility for different sewing projects. Basic machines may offer 10-20 stitches, while advanced models can have over 100. Consider what types of projects you plan to work on and choose a machine with the appropriate number of stitch options. If you mainly do simple sewing, fewer stitches may suffice, but for more creative or complex projects, a wider range of stitches is beneficial.
Speed ControlSpeed control allows you to adjust the sewing speed, which is measured in stitches per minute (SPM). This feature is important for both beginners and experienced sewers. Beginners may prefer a slower speed to maintain control, while experienced sewers might want a faster speed for efficiency. Machines typically range from 600 to 1,100 SPM. Choose a machine with adjustable speed settings to match your skill level and project requirements.
Built-in StitchesBuilt-in stitches are pre-programmed stitch patterns available on the sewing machine. These can include utility stitches, decorative stitches, and stretch stitches. The number of built-in stitches can range from a few dozen to several hundred. If you enjoy experimenting with different stitch patterns or need specific stitches for your projects, opt for a machine with a higher number of built-in stitches. For basic sewing needs, a machine with fewer built-in stitches will suffice.
Buttonhole StylesButtonhole styles refer to the different types of buttonholes a sewing machine can create. Common styles include basic, keyhole, and stretch buttonholes. Some machines offer one-step buttonholes, which are easier and more consistent, while others have four-step buttonholes that require more manual adjustments. If you frequently sew garments with buttons, a machine with multiple buttonhole styles and one-step buttonholes can be very useful.
Presser FeetPresser feet are attachments that hold the fabric in place while sewing. Different presser feet are designed for various tasks, such as zippers, buttonholes, and quilting. A machine with a variety of presser feet included or available as accessories can enhance your sewing capabilities. Consider the types of projects you plan to undertake and ensure the machine comes with or supports the presser feet you need.
Bobbin SystemThe bobbin system is the mechanism that holds the lower thread in a sewing machine. There are two main types: front-loading and top-loading. Top-loading bobbins are generally easier to insert and monitor, making them more user-friendly. Front-loading bobbins can be more challenging to access but are often found in more traditional machines. Choose a bobbin system that you find easy to use and maintain.
Machine Weight and PortabilityThe weight and portability of a sewing machine are important if you need to move it frequently or have limited space. Lighter machines are easier to transport and store, while heavier machines tend to be more stable and durable. Consider where you will be using the machine and how often you will need to move it. If you attend sewing classes or need to store the machine when not in use, a lighter, more portable model may be ideal.
LCD ScreenAn LCD screen on a sewing machine displays important information such as stitch selection, settings, and error messages. This feature can make the machine easier to use and more intuitive, especially for beginners. Machines with larger, more detailed screens provide better visibility and more information. If you prefer a more modern and user-friendly interface, look for a machine with a clear and informative LCD screen.
Warranty and SupportThe warranty and support offered by the manufacturer are important considerations when purchasing a sewing machine. A good warranty provides peace of mind and protection against defects and malfunctions. Support services, such as customer service and repair options, are also valuable. Check the warranty terms and available support services before making a purchase to ensure you have the necessary assistance if issues arise.
